5Feminine Grace: Modesty in Its Finest Form

The winter punjabi suit reflects feminine grace and modesty. The long tunic (kameez) and flowing trousers (salwar) create a style that highlights elegance while adhering to customary values of humility and poise. It is this balance between tradition and style that makes the suit an enduring favorite.

Q

Can you explain the cultural significance of the zari work in Gulbhahar's winter punjabi suits?

A

The zari work in Gulbhahar's winter punjabi suits is not just decorative; it carries a deep cultural significance. Zari, often made of gold or silver thread, symbolizes prosperity and good fortune. Wearing these suits during auspicious occasions like weddings and festivals brings blessings and honors family traditions while showcasing feminine grace.
